UK and Ukraine Sign 100 Year Partnership Agreement – Day 1057 (January 16, 2025)

War Updates

Summary of the Day: Ukrainian forces launched strategic strikes against key Russian infrastructure, targeting the Lisinskaya Oil Refinery in Voronezh […]